Great Yarmouth's The Edge gets the go-ahead

Plans for a £35m casino, hotel and leisure complex were approved today (27 November) by Great Yarmouth Borough Council.

The complex, called The Edge, have been put forward by Pleasure and Leisure Corporation (PLC) – owner of the Pleasure Beach attraction – in collaboration with Aspers Casino, as part of a bid to secure a large casino licence allocated to the town by central government. If the licence is won, the 100,000sq ft (9,290sq m) development will contain a 65,000 sq ft casino featuring roulette, gaming tables, slot machines with jackpots up to £4,000, restaurants, bars, a beauty salon, an iPod lounge and facilities for live entertainment.

The plans for the complex will be located on a former caravan park next to the outer harbour. for a former caravan park next to the outer harbour. The complex, designed by architectural firm ColladoCollins, will also include a 138-room hotel, a multiplex eight-screen cinema and an 18-lane bowling alley. According to Jones a number of "blue chip companies within the leisure industry" have already been selected as potential tenants.

Albert Jones, managing director of PLC, said construction on his plan could begin quickly if approval is granted, making for a potential 2012 opening. “We have the empty site, planning details, and funding in place,” he said.

Construction on the winning scheme will not begin until at least 2010, when the council reaches a decision on a casino license, which could take at least 18 months. There are, reportedly, other developers looking to get their hands on the licence with intentions to build a casino complex on the council-owned Golden Mile site currently occupied by the Marina Centre and on river bank sites. But no other schemes have reached the formal planning stage.
